What Is an AI Writing Helper?
An AI writing helper is a tool powered by artificial intelligence that assists you throughout the writing process. It's not a magic button that does your thinking for you. It's an intelligent assistant that handles the tedious parts—grammar corrections, sentence structure, word choice, and content organization—so you can focus on what actually matters: your ideas.
Think of it like having a writing coach available 24/7. One that never gets tired, never judges, and catches mistakes you'd miss after reading the same paragraph twelve times.
These tools analyze your text using advanced language models trained on massive datasets. They identify patterns, spot errors, and suggest improvements in real-time. Why You Actually Need an AI Writing Assistant
Let's cut through the noise. Here's what the data shows:
According to a 2024 Microsoft Work Trend Index report, 75% of knowledge workers globally now use AI writing tools—and nearly half started within the last six months. This isn't a trend. It's a shift.
A comprehensive systematic review published in Frontiers in Education (2025) analyzing 136 academic studies found that students using AI writing tools showed significant improvements in text coherence, discursive organization, lexical richness, and argumentation quality. The research confirms what users already know: these tools work.

How AI Writing Tools Actually Work
When you know how something works, you can use it better. Here's the basic version.
Modern AI writing assistants utilize large language models (LLMs) trained on hundreds of billions of texts. Unlike a typical spellchecker, the tool doesn’t merely reference a dictionary. It examines context, intent, and flow depending on patterns learned from massive amounts of superb quality writing.
Here’s how the procedure works.
- Input Analysis – The AI reads your text and identifies structural elements, sentence boundaries, and grammatical relationships
- Pattern Recognition – It compares your writing against learned patterns of effective communication
- Suggestion Generation – Based on discrepancies between your text and optimal patterns, it generates corrections and improvements
- Contextual Adaptation – Advanced tools adjust suggestions based on your writing style, audience, and purpose
The best tools don't force you into a generic mold. They learn your preferences and enhance your natural voice rather than replacing it.

Non-Native English Speakers
Writing in a second language adds friction that native speakers never experience. AI writing helpers level this playing field by catching errors that feel natural to write but sound awkward to native readers. They help with idiom usage, article placement, and the subtle conventions that take years to internalize naturally.

AI Writing Helper vs. Traditional Proofreading
Some argue human proofreaders remain superior. Here's the honest comparison:
| Aspect | AI Writing Helper | Human Proofreader |
|---|---|---|
| Speed | Instant | Hours to days |
| Availability | 24/7 | Limited hours |
| Cost | Low/free options available | $25-50+ per hour |
| Consistency | Always applies same standards | Varies by tiredness, mood |
| Context Understanding | Improving but imperfect | Superior nuance detection |
| Scalability | Handles any volume | Limited capacity |
| Feedback Learning | Immediate | Delayed |
The reality? The best approach often combines both. Use AI for immediate, comprehensive error checking and efficiency. Bring in human reviewers for high-stakes documents where contextual nuance matters most.
For daily writing tasks—emails, reports, blog posts, assignments—AI alone typically suffices. The cost-benefit equation overwhelmingly favors automated assistance.

Common Mistakes When Using AI Writing Assistant
Avoid these pitfalls to get the most from your tool:
Over-Reliance Leading to Skill Atrophy
The research warns against this. Students who blindly accept every AI suggestion without understanding why may develop dependency that hinders long-term learning. Use AI as a teacher, not a crutch.
Ignoring Context-Specific Needs
Generic AI suggestions don't always fit specialized contexts. Technical writing, legal documents, and creative pieces have conventions the AI might not recognize. Stay aware of domain-specific requirements.
Forgetting the Human Review
AI output requires human oversight. Always. Review everything before sending, submitting, or publishing. The tool assists; you decide.
Accepting First Suggestions Without Exploration
Many AI writing helpers offer multiple alternative suggestions. The first isn't always best. Explore options to find improvements that truly enhance your writing.
